We evaluate a new MAC layer algorithm based on slotted ALOHA with successive interference cancellation(SIC) for IEEE 802.11p vehicular communications standard and test it by taking into consideration the performance of underlying physical layer in the presence of a realistic empirical fading channel model. The performance of slotted ALOHA-SIC MAC scheme with respect to average packet loss ratio, throughput, and channel access delay is studied. This scheme can significantly improve the channel access delay and throughput performance in vehicular networks when compared to the carrier sense multiple access scheme proposed in 802.11.
